Cat And Bear

Rate this book
Bear arrives in a big red box for the child's birthday, and the child loves him immediately. Cat, used to coming first in the child's affections, is unimpressed, and tries all sorts of tricks to stop child loving bear. Then one day, bear disappears and only Cat can help.

32 pages, Paperback

First published January 1, 1998

Friendship and jealousy are the themes in this story of a child's birthday gift that is totally unacceptable to the cat. When Bear arrives, Cat feels nothing but contempt for this unnecessary being. The child already has a friend - Cat. Cat does his best to do away with Bear - he pushes him into the bath water and out the window. But Cat has a conscience and Child has enough love in her heart for both Cat and Bear. A bit wordy for the very young, but for slightly older children, this beautifully and colorfully illustrated story is a sweet lesson in love.
